Direct Your Players In Their Interests, Needs & Ability


    Interest/ Needs/ Abilities—direct your players in this way. 
 How you will handle the team.
We are constantly looking for the best way to Teach/ Coach our team.  As we head into a new week of practice after a game and preparing for another--we look for the best way to communicate our message.
The first thing we must look at are the Interest, Needs & Abilities of each player.
This is critical because each player is at a different point in each of these areas.  So we must bring clarity to the situation.  Basically, asking "What are we trying to do here?"
We want the, "Next Best Action"..
To determine our Next Best Action, we look at those needs and then determine what is the outcome we desire..Then, what must we commit to accomplish this desire. Next, is simply what's the next thing needed to do to move toward that goal.
A few things that we do to meet the Interest, Needs & Abilities:
1.  Use film to Show, Encourage & Conclude with a Challenge.
2.  Individual reps of a situation or skill needed.
3.  Identify their ability to be able to master the skill.
